Marine-Grade Glass Fiber Chopped Strand Mat – Saltwater-Resistant Composite Material
Product Overview
Marine-Grade Glass Fiber Chopped Strand Mat is engineered for saltwater immersion and abrasion resistance. Featuring closed-cell structure and non-corrosive binders, it's ideal for boat hulls, offshore platforms, and desalination plant piping.
Key Features
  • Anti-Fouling: Resists biofouling in marine environments
  • Flexibility: 300% elongation at break for curved surfaces
  • Fire Safety: Class A flame retardancy (ASTM E84)
Applications
Component Function
Hull Coatings Structural sandwich core
Mooring Systems High-load tension members
Offshore Wind Anchors Fatigue-resistant composite joints
Technical Specifications
Parameter Value
Chloride Ion Resistance ≤0.1% weight loss (ASTM B117)
Impact Resistance ≥25 kJ/m² (Pendulum Test)
Thermal Expansion 5×10⁻⁶/°C (−40°C to +80°C)
Packaging & Storage
  • Primary: Aramid paper-wrapped rolls to prevent UV degradation
  • Bulk: Vacuum-sealed bags with nitrogen flushing
  • Critical Storage: Maintain ≤50% RH to avoid delamination
